What to Know About FedEx in Hampton, South Carolina

Hampton, South Carolina, located in Hampton County, has a small population of around 4,140 residents. The city is situated in the low country region of South Carolina, characterized by its flat topography and proximity to wetlands, which can influence transportation logistics and delivery routes. The local infrastructure includes several major roads, such as U.S. Route 278 and South Carolina Highway 3, which facilitate access for carriers like FedEx. However, the relatively rural setting may present occasional delays due to less frequent traffic or road conditions, especially during inclement weather events common to coastal regions, such as storms or heavy rainfall.

The historical development of Hampton dates back to the late 19th century, with its economy historically rooted in agriculture and manufacturing, which has led to a close-knit community that relies on efficient delivery services. FedEx operates in this area, typically providing reliable delivery times. However, the overall population density in the region is low, which may mean fewer daily shipments in comparison to more urban areas. In terms of weather, South Carolina experiences a humid subtropical climate, resulting in hot summers and mild winters, both factors that can affect shipping schedules, particularly during summer storms or occasional winter cold snaps. Customers can generally expect their packages to arrive within standard timeframes, though external factors should always be considered.

We Make Your FedEx Delivery CO2 positive

The receipt of a shipment causes about 500g CO2. A tree can bind about one ton of CO2 in a lifetime. To be climate neutral this would be 1 tree for 2000 sendings. But CO2 neutral is not enough! That's why we plant a tree at least every 1000 FedEx shipments and thus make the receipt of FedEx parcels climate positive for all users.
